Keynote Speaker - Dr Linda O Keeffe (Edinburgh School of Art)

We are delighted to confirm Dr Linda O Keeffe as our keynote speaker. Dr O Keeffe is Head of the School of Art at Edinburgh College of Art. She is both an artist and social scientist and many of her projects, which include solo exhibitions, performances and public installations, have had a multi-disciplinary aspect to them. Her most recent body of work focused on the impact of renewable technology soundscapes on rural environments and subsequently the further impact on local community soundscapes.

This has involved working with ecologists, environmentalists and technologists as well as engaging with communities, activists and artists. A body of that work is currently touring, Hybrid Soundscapes I-IV, as part of the Sounds Like Her exhibition. Past works have focused on sound through the theories of phenomenology and perception, examining the connections between communities and their urban spaces. This practice has involved deep investigations of the social construction of sound alongside an interrogation of urban planning and sensory management projects.

O Keeffe is founder of the feminist research group Women in Sound Women on Sound an international collective focused on making visible women in the field of sonic arts and sound studies research www.wiswos.com, she is also editor in chief of the Interference Journal, a journal of audio cultures www.interferencejournal.org www.lindaokeeffe.com
